A longer piece broadcast in Australia within a week of Cook's death in January 1995.

It looks to me like this was made by British television (BBC presumably) and slightly adapted to increase its relevance to Australian viewers (by adding a comment from Max Gillies, for instance, and a bit of archive footage of Cook and Barry Humphries in Melbourne).

Contains archive footage & photographs, and comments from Dudley Moore, Ian Hislop & Richard Ingrams of Private Eye,Max Gillies (Australian satirist) and Peter Nolloth (friend of Cook).
